Both guidebook and digital rails are offered for acquisition. One ought to anticipate to pay an extra $75 $400. For those that require an IV pole, there are both IV poles that connect to hospital beds and freestanding IV posts. One ought to expect to pay around $50. Various other attachments for home hospital beds include bed trays, table trays, bedpans, call cords, and bed rail pads.


Leasing a home healthcare facility bed (handbook, semi-electric, and full-electric) is a great option for those that will only need it for a limited amount of time. This is a a lot more price efficient choice for temporary use. Usually, it sets you back one $200 $500/ month to rent a home hospital bed.


Some companies that lease home healthcare facility beds may charge a preliminary charge for set-up. To assist in one's search for home medical facility beds, below is a checklist of trustworthy manufacturers.

While even more cost effective than electrical versions, these beds call for physical initiative for adjustments. The main advantages of manual beds are their price and dependability, as they don't rely on electrical energy. The demand for hand-operated initiative can be a constraint in scenarios where fast changes are necessary or where caregivers face physical obstacles.


They are fit for individuals that call for minimal rearranging for convenience or medical needs. Semi-electric healthcare facility beds supply an equilibrium of guidebook and electric controls. The head and foot areas are typically changed with electrical controls, while the height is changed manually. These beds give an ideal happy medium between guidebook and totally electric choices, using convenience of use without the complete cost of electric designs.


Semi-electric beds are well-suited for patients that need moderate changes to the head and foot areas yet can manage without regular height adjustments. This makes them a cost-efficient service for those looking for comfort and benefit without the need for constant repositioning. Totally electric medical facility beds feature electric controls for seamless adjustments to the elevation, head, and foot sections.

Pressure injuries are a major difficulty in medical care facilities. They're common among elderly and critically unwell clients, especially in extensive care units (ICUs) and nursing homes.




Pressure injuries and skin abscess set you back healthcare home facilities approximately $70,000 per occurrence, and endanger Medicare and Medicaid repayment. Hospitals can conserve cash and aid their individuals heal through the intro of a digital bed. Exact and prompt data collection is vital in modern health care. Nurses and clinical aides are in charge of charting hundreds of crucial indicators during every 12-hour shift.


Patient drops are ruining and raise warnings for governing companies like The Joint Compensation. Healthcare facilities can minimize the possibilities of client injury by introducing electronic beds with integrated alarm system systems - Hospital Beds For Home Use. This autumn alarm is frequently constructed right into the bed mattress, making it simple to initiate in the instance of patient delirium
